BBC fans all say same thing minutes into Eurovision 2025 semi-final as they ‘get chills’ The first semi-final of the Eurovision Song Contest 2025 kicked off on Tuesday. Daily Express :: TV and Radio Feed 'get 2025 chills’ Eurovision fans into minutes same semifinal They Thing 2025-05-13 admin